Niue Signs Chemical Weapons Convention


Niue last week signed the Chemical Weapons Convention, according to a statement released yesterday by the Organization for the Prohibition of Chemical Weapons (see GSN, Oct. 22, 2004).

The South Pacific island will become the 168th party to the convention on May 21, the organization announced (Organization for the Prohibition of Chemical Weapons release, April 27).
